Latest Patents

One of his latest patents is a gas monitoring image recording device, method, and program. This invention involves acquiring gas monitoring image data that includes multiple time-series images for monitoring gas leaks. The device extracts a leakage candidate area based on the acquired data and identifies features related to the gas leak. The extracted features are then stored in association with the gas monitoring image data.

Another significant patent is a recording method and apparatus for a thermoreversible recording medium. This method records images on a thermosensible medium containing liquid crystal material. The cholesteric liquid crystal reflects selected wavelengths of light based on temperature, allowing for precise control over the recording color. The method optimizes energy application time by adjusting the pulse width and number of applied energy pulses.
